Given
Mass of the truck, m=4500 kg
Speed of th etruck, u=20 m/s
Time required , t=9 m/s
To find
The braking force
Explanation
Since the car stops so the final velocity is v=0
Thus the acceleration of the truck is
[tex]\begin{gathered} a=\frac{v-u}{t} \\ \Rightarrow a=\frac{0-20}{9}=-2.22m/s^2 \end{gathered}[/tex]The negative sign says that the speed is decreasing i.e. decelaration is occuring
Thus the braking force is (considering only the magnitude)
[tex]\begin{gathered} F=ma \\ \Rightarrow F=4500\times2.22=9990\text{ N} \end{gathered}[/tex]Conclusion
The braking force is 9990 N
